2010-05-18 79 views
0

昨天我觉得我的所有项目都会遇到大问题。在我安装了新的Xcode 3.2.3(对于iPhone OS 4)之后,我的所有项目都开始吐出“引用自:”的错误。我注意到在新的Xcode中,所有早于3.2的iPhone SDK版本都被删除了。但是我有一个在Xcode 3.2.2上为iPhone SDK 3.2完美构建的项目,但在Xcode 3.2.3上为iPhone SDK 3.2构建了错误。从Xcode 3.2.2到Xcode 3.2.3

在此先感谢!

alt text http://www.freeimagehosting.net/uploads/528f450e71.png


我已经缩小问题的范围,现在我明白了,这个问题是因为可达性类的,虽然它是从苹果官方的样本复制。我认为苹果开发者只是删除了一些标准库的链接。但是,什么链接?无论如何,我确定有人看到这个问题,因为它是由可达性(99%使用这个类)造成的!

很多感谢提前!

screenshot http://www.freeimagehosting.net/uploads/528f450e71.png

回答

1

类型“从引用:”的错误只是意味着一些框架应予以补充。它与Reachability类一起工作(只需添加SystemConfiguration框架)。但是twitter api拒绝工作。这就是为什么我的旧项目拒绝在新的Xcode上编译 - 因为Twitter API(MGTwitterEngine)不适用于OS4(Xcode 3.2.3)。 :( 这真的很糟糕:((